TREE PLANTING

Each year we identify blocks within the historic district in need of trees, and have planted 40+ trees in the past five years. Here is a volunteer crew at Bampa’s House on East First Street.

FLAGS & LUMINARIES

Neighborhood volunteers festoon blocks with American flags to celebrate national holidays. Luminaries were distributed along sidewalks to add cheer to the 2020 holiday season.

NEIGHBORHOOD YARD SALES

Every few years, we rally homeowners for a group yard sale day. SNA covers the advertising and signage, and participants manage their sale and keep the proceeds.

HISTORIC MARKERS

SNA coordinates maintenance for Corning’s historic markers, and works to identify potential sites. Signs will be fabricated and installed in 2021 to recognize the War Memorial Library and the home of Amo Houghton.

ANNUAL CAP AWARDS

Each year, SNA recognizes significant improvements by property owners in the historic district through the Corning Architectural Preservation (CAP) and “CAP’s Off” awards.
